Flavia de Campos Mello is Professor at the Department of International Relations, Pontifical Catholic University of São Paulo (PUC-SP), and at the San Tiago Dantas Graduate Program in International Relations (UNESP/UNICAMP/PUC-SP). She is currently Coordinator of the International Relations Research Group on Global Governance at PUC-São Paulo (NERI-PUC), a researcher at the Brazilian National Institute of Science and Technology for Studies on the United States (INCT-INEU) and a founding member of the Latin American Institute for Multilateralism (ILAM). Her most recent publications include studies on multilateralism and global governance.
